(Japanese: ヒトモシ Hitomoshi) is a dual-type Ghost/Fire Pokémon introduced in Generation V.
It evolves into Ranpuraa starting at level 41 and then into Shandera when exposed to a Dusk Stone.
Biology
Physiology
Hitomoshi has a blue flame atop his head. Its body is made up primarily of white wax. The folded, melted wax lays over its left eye, and leaves only the bright yellow right eye visible. It has a small smile.

Origin
Hitomoshi is a combination of onibi (a blue, black, or purple-fire associated with ghosts and youkai, equivalent to the western Wil-O-Wisp) and a candle.
Name origin
Its name seems to be a corruption of 灯火 tomoshibi, lamplight, and 火 hi, meaning "fire".
